Changing States through Heat

Observing how adding or removing heat can change the physical properties of common substances.

Key Questions

  1. 1How does temperature change the way a material behaves?
  2. 2What would happen if we tried to build a house out of chocolate on a sunny day?
  3. 3How do we know if a change caused by heating can be reversed?
